the holidays were mixed with cultural and religious holidays. one of the most important festival is called Leylet en Nuktah. it is where the civilians celebrate the flooding of the Nile River

Jewish people celebrate Passover to celebrate their people's liberation from slavery. The holiday celebrates when Jews were freed from slavery in Ancient Egypt.
